A breathtaking art form, sand animation allows the artist to create enchanting worlds where magic exists, and space and time become irrelevant. A unique medium, sand is somehow more tangible and captivating than hand-drawn animation. Created live in front of audiences, sand stories evolve as the artist erases previous images and advances the narrative before guests’ very eyes.
